Market Context

Trading activity for OSG today is aligned with normal volume patterns, with no unusual spikes or declines in share turnover observed as of mid-session. The broader specialty services sector, which Octave Specialty Group Inc. operates within, has seen uneven performance this month, as investors balance concerns over macroeconomic interest rate trends with optimism around niche service demand from small and mid-sized corporate clients. No recent earnings data is available for OSG as of this analysis, and no material company-specific news announcements have been released in recent weeks, meaning current price action is being driven almost entirely by technical trading flows and broad sector sentiment. Peer stocks in the same segment have posted average gains in the low single digits this month, providing a modest tailwind for OSG’s recent upward move, though risk-off shifts in broader market sentiment could erase those gains quickly if investor appetite for small-cap assets weakens. Technical Analysis

From a technical standpoint, OSG is currently trading between two well-established near-term price levels: support at $4.62 and resistance at $5.1. The $4.62 support level has held consistently during pullbacks over the past few weeks, with buyers stepping in to absorb selling pressure each time the price approaches that threshold, limiting downside moves on all recent dips. On the upside, the $5.1 resistance level has been tested three separate times this month, with sellers entering the market in large enough volumes to prevent a sustained break above that mark on each prior occasion. OSG’s relative strength index (RSI) is currently in the neutral range, suggesting the stock is neither overbought nor oversold at current price levels, which could leave room for further near-term movement in either direction depending on market flows. The stock is also trading slightly above its short-term moving average range, but remains below its medium-term moving average levels, a signal that longer-term momentum is still muted even as short-term price action trends positive. Outlook

Looking ahead, there are two key scenarios that technical analysts are monitoring for OSG in upcoming sessions. First, if the stock continues to build on its recent 2.32% gain and holds above current price levels, it could possibly test the $5.1 resistance level in the near term. A sustained break above that resistance, accompanied by above-average trading volume, would likely signal a shift in short-term momentum, though broad market volatility could potentially derail that trajectory. On the downside, if broader risk sentiment weakens across small-cap stocks, OSG might pull back to test the $4.62 support level. A break below that support could lead to further near-term consolidation, per market expectations for technical price action. With no public, scheduled company-specific catalysts on the horizon as of this analysis, Octave Specialty Group Inc.’s price action may continue to track broader sector trends and the interaction with its key support and resistance levels for the foreseeable future.
